On Monday 31 January 2011 22:21:14 Mike Diehl wrote:
> Steve Edwards wrote:
> > On Mon, 31 Jan 2011, Mike Diehl wrote:
> >> I've got an agi script that calls the directory function, which seems
> >> to work to a point.  However, once the caller has selected an entry,
> >> I need my agi script to find out which extension was selected.  I've
> >> RTFM'd and don't see that the extension is returned.  Nor is a
> >> variable set, as far as I can see.
> >> 
> >> Is there a way to get this information from the directory
> >> application?
> > 
> > No channel variable is set, but it would be a simple modification to
> > the source code to return the extension instead of dialing it.
> 
> Is this a patch that anyone else would be interested in?  I could
> probably figure out how to accept a flag, say 'r', and return the
> extension.  I'm not an official asterisk developer, but I could/would
> sign a release. --

Mike, that sounds great.  The right way to go about this is through the
issue tracker at https://issues.asterisk.org.  This is also where you would
need to sign your license agreement for the contribution.  Just mark your
issue as Severity: Feature, and it'll probably find its way into 1.10.
